When a ship carrying settlers from Earth to Mars is knocked off-course, passengers must wrestle with the reality that home may be a lot further away than they thought. Crew member MR operates a sentient computer that allows humans to experience idyllic memories of their lives on Earth. As the ship drifts further into space, MR must keep passengers calm amid a growing sense of disaster.

Chronicles the efforts of nature photographer James Balog to document the receding of the Solheim glacier in Iceland, a consequence of climate change and global warming, in which strategically placed cameras would take one picture every hour for three years.
